Fixing the surface
Fixing the cooking surface to the unit must be done as follows:
Arrange the surface in the hole on the unit making sure it is central.
Fix the surface to the unit with the appropriate supplied brackets as shown in fig 9.
Installing the sealant correctly offers a complete guarantee against liquid infiltration.
Area of installation and discharging the products caused by combustion.
The appliance must be installed and used in suitable areas and in any case it must be in conformity with laws in vigour.
The installer must refer to laws in vigour concerning ventilation and evacuation of combustion products.
It is reminded that the necessary area for combustion is 2m3/h per kW of power (gas) installed.
Area of installation
The area where the gas appliance is installed must have a natural flow of air, necessary for gas combustion (standards UNI-CIG 7129
and 7131).
The flow of air must come form one or more openings made on a free section that is at least 100 cm2 (A).
This opening must be constructed in a manner so that it is not obstructed internally or externally and must be near the floor, preferably
on the opposite side of combustion product evacuation.
When it is not possible to make these openings the air can come from an adjacent room, ventilated as required, as long as this room is
not a bedroom, have a dangerous environment or sunk down (UNI-CIG 7129).
Combustion products unload
The gas cooking apparatus have to unload the combustion products through hoods directly connected to chimney flue or directly to the
outside (fig. 10).
Should it not be possible to install a hood, the use of an electric fan applied to an external wall or to the room window is necessary.
This electric fan must have a hold which guarantees an air change in the kitchen of at least 3-5 times its volume (UNI-CIG 7129).

Connection to the gas plant
Before installing, ensure that the local distribution conditions (gas nature and pressure) and the surface adjustments are
compatible.
To do this, verify the data of the product label applied on the surface and on this book.
The gas connection must be carried out in conformity with rules UNI-CIG 7129 and 7131. The cooking surface must be connected to
the gas plant using stiff metal tubes or stainless steel flexible tubes at continuous wall, consonant to rule UNI-CIG 9891 with maximum
extension of 2 m.
Ensure that, in case using flexible metal tubes, these do not come into contact with moving parts or are crushed.
Carry out the connection so as not to cause any kind of stress on the apparatus.
The gas input connection is threaded G
For ISO R7 connections, it is not necessary to interpose the gasket.
For ISO R228 connections, it is necessary to interpose the head wheel provided.
